Amplience è un CMS headless incentrato sulle API che consente a sviluppatori e gestori di contenuti di collaborare in modo efficiente, disaccoppiando la creazione e la presentazione dei contenuti per sviluppare in modo più rapido siti web e app.
Il connettore Amplience consente di gestire i contenuti all'interno della piattaforma Amplience attraverso la logica di personalizzazione di Dynamic Yield. Quando crei campagne API lato server, potrai selezionare e utilizzare i contenuti che hai impostato in precedenza nel tuo account Amplience.
Implementare l'integrazione
1. Attiva il connettore:
- Nello store Experience OS, vai su Amplience › Learn More e poi clicca su Install.
L' Si aprirà la scheda Estensioni di personalizzazione web. - Clicca sul pulsante di stato e seleziona Activate.
2. Configura il connettore:
- Client ID: l'ID client (chiave API) fornito all'utente da Amplience,
- Client Secret: il client scret fornito all'utente da Amplience,
- Hub Name: il nome dell'hub fornito da Amplience,
- content_type_uid: l'ID del tipo di contenuto da sincronizzare con Dynamic Yield e da utilizzare nelle relative campagne.
Sfrutta il pannello Anteprima voci per assicurati che l'ID client, il client secret, il nome dell'hub e gli ID del tipo di contenuto siano corretti.
3. Salva la configurazione. Ora puoi creare campagne con le voci di Amplience.
Creare varianti con le voci di Amplience
L'integrazione serve ad aggiungere un tipo di variabile ID voce Amplience a modelli e varianti nei seguenti tipi di campagna:
- Web Personalization: codice personalizzato API e raccomandazioni API,
- App Personalization: codice personalizzato API e raccomandazioni API.
Per utilizzare questa variabile nella variante o nel modello:
- nella scheda JSON crea una variabile e, quindi, modificane il tipo in Amplience Entry ID.
- Nella scheda Variabili, nel campo Content ID, cerca le voci di Amplience per nome o ID, quindi, seleziona il contenuto che vuoi usare. L'ID contenuto verrà aggiunto al codice JSON.
La risposta dell'API
Quando indirizzi gli utenti a questa variante, la risposta dell'API includerà il relativo ID contenuto. Usa queste informazioni per creare il riferimento tra i contenuti Amplience (ad esempio, immagini o testi) e il front-end dell'app.